Studio Bitte posters

Ninna (by Margot Lévêque) and Labil Grotesk (by Christian Jánský) are used for the typographic posters created and sold by Studio Bitte. They stem from a love for Danish language's rhymes and verses, children’s songs, ballads, and wordplay.
